PERE MARQUETTE TOWNSHIP — A 32-year-old Ludington man was arrested by Mason County sheriff deputies Friday, Nov. 18, at 1:14 p.m. for damaging property after he reportedly “became upset and loud” inside the Social Security Office on North Jebavy Drive “over what he felt was unfair treatment,” said Mason County Sheriff Kim Cole.

“When asked to leave, he allegedly punched the wall with his fist causing damage to the wall,” the sheriff said.

  • 5:35 a.m., (MCSO), a 27-year-old Grandville man and a 24-year-old Comstock Park woman left the Ludington State Park in Hamlin Township in a 14-foot boat to duck hunt on Hamlin Lake when their boat took on water and sank, according to Cole. The couple was able to beach the boat but were unaware of where they were. The two were located by two deputies approximately a half mile away from the boat launch. They were uninjured.
